5.8.
Totalizer Pulse Output
Each time the flow meter reaches a unit flow, it may generate a totalizer pulse output to a remote counter.
The totalizer pulse output can be transmitted through OCT or a relay. Therefore, it is necessary to configure OCT
and the relay accordingly. (Please refer to Window M33 and M34). For example, if it is necessary to transmit the
positive totalizer pulse through a relay, and each pulse represents a flow of 10m3, the configuration is as follows:
In Window M41-Unit, select the totalizer flow unit "m3";
In Window M41-MULT, select the scale factor "e. x10";
In Window M34-Option, select "g. POS Total ";
5.9.
Alarm Programming
The on-off output alarm is generated through OCT or transmission to an external circuit by opening or closing a
relay. The on-off output signal is activated under the following conditions:
(1)
Signal not detected;
(2)
Poor signal detected;
(3)
The flow meter is not ready for normal measurement;
(4)
The flow is in the reverse direction (back flow).
(5)
The analog outputs exceed span by 120%.
(6)
The frequency output exceeds span by 120%.
(7)
The flow rate exceeds the ranges configured (Configure the flow ranges using the software alarm system.
There are two software alarms: Alarm#1 and Alarm #2.
Example 1: When flow rate exceeds 300 ~ 1000 m
3
/h, in order to program the relay output alarm, Complete the
steps as follows:
(1)
In Menu 35, Alarm1 LowL 300;
(2)
In Menu 35, Alarm1 Upper 1000;
(3)
In Menu 34, Relay Setting-Option-d.Alarm1

Attention
Make sure to select an appropriate totalizer pulse. If the totalizer pulse is too big, the output
cycle will be too long; if the totalizer is too small, the relay will operate too faster, you may
shorten the life of the relay, as well as skip some pulses. The totalizer is recommended to
transmit within the range of 1 ~ 3 pulse per second.
